Key responsibilities for this Events and Administration Assistant position:
\n\n- \n\t
- Assist in planning, coordinating, and delivering over 50 industry-leading events annually as the Events and Administration Assistant \n\t
- Manage logistics and communications with speakers, sponsors, partners, and venues to ensure seamless execution \n\t
- Provide cross-departmental administrative support to editorial, commercial, and events teams as an integral Events and Administration Assistant \n\t
- Support client onboarding and post-campaign analytics within the commercial team \n\t
- Maintain internal systems and CRM databases to improve accuracy, compliance, and data quality \n\t
- Promote events through marketing channels including email, social media, and direct outreach \n\t
- Contribute to the evolution of event formats and product offerings as a proactive Events and Administration Assistant \n\t
- Represent the company as a professional point of contact for clients, speakers, and key stakeholders \n
